c# - 什么是 BitmapData.reserved?

标签 c# .net bitmap bitmapdata

BitmapData 有一个名为 Reserved 的属性,它返回一个 32 位 signed integer。 Microsoft 的文档说不要使用此属性。如果我们不应该使用它;那它为什么在那里?它到底是做什么用的?

最佳答案

保留字段和属性可以有多种用途。一种相当常见的用法是允许更复杂类型的 BitmapData 将来可能需要存储当前结构未提供的某种类型的信息。如果没有人将 Reserved 字段用于任何事情,则 future 的实现可以使用该字段来保存指向包含附加信息的另一个结构的指针或句柄。

关于c# - 什么是 BitmapData.reserved?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/6417707/

相关文章:

c# - Linux 中带有 Mono : Ends of labels are cut off (Autosizing issue? 的 WinForms C# 应用程序)

c# - 正则表达式脑抽筋 - 匹配 "foreign"但不匹配 "foreign key"

c# - 从 Microsoft Groove 音乐应用程序获取当前播放轨道信息

c# - 字符串中字段值的正则表达式匹配

c# - 首次请求时 Amazon SimpleDB 高延迟

.net - VFP OleDb 的 Sql 参数化语法错误

C++:在另一个 Graphics* 对象内绘制 Graphics* 对象的最佳方式

c - 如何创建位图(在 C 中)?

java - Android:如何像现在这样快速执行这个for循环?

c# - 如何创建具有多个方法调用的 ExpressionTree